Iraq, despite its recent challenges, is demonstrating remarkable resilience and embarking on a path of economic recovery and growth. With its vast oil reserves, strategic location, and a young and growing population, Iraq presents a compelling case for international businesses seeking untapped opportunities in the Middle East.

A Recovering Economy, Poised for Growth

Iraq’s economy has shown positive signs of recovery in recent years, driven by rising oil prices and government efforts to rebuild infrastructure and diversify its economy.

  • Oil and Gas Sector: As a major global oil producer, Iraq’s oil and gas sector remains a key driver of economic growth, attracting significant foreign investment.
  • Reconstruction and Infrastructure: The Iraqi government is prioritizing infrastructure development, including roads, bridges, power plants, and housing, creating opportunities for international construction and engineering firms.
  • Growing Consumer Market: With a young and growing population of over 40 million, Iraq presents a significant consumer market for goods and services, particularly in sectors like food and beverage, telecommunications, and consumer electronics.

Promising Sectors for International Businesses

Beyond oil and gas, several sectors in Iraq hold significant potential for international investors and businesses.

  • Agriculture: Iraq has vast tracts of fertile land suitable for agriculture. Investing in modern agricultural techniques, irrigation systems, and food processing can enhance food security and create export opportunities.
  • Healthcare: The Iraqi healthcare system is undergoing modernization and expansion, creating a demand for medical equipment, pharmaceuticals, and healthcare services.
  • Energy: While oil and gas dominate Iraq’s energy sector, there is growing interest in renewable energy sources, particularly solar power, to diversify the energy mix and address environmental concerns.
  • Telecommunications and IT: Iraq’s telecommunications sector is experiencing rapid growth, driven by increasing mobile phone and internet penetration, creating opportunities for telecom operators, infrastructure providers, and IT services companies.

Navigating the Business Landscape

While opportunities abound, it’s essential to acknowledge the challenges and approach the Iraqi market strategically.

  • Security: Security remains a concern in certain areas of Iraq. Conducting thorough due diligence, partnering with reputable local companies, and seeking expert advice on security protocols are crucial.
  • Regulatory Environment: Iraq’s regulatory environment is evolving. Staying informed about legal and regulatory changes, obtaining necessary licenses and permits, and working with legal experts specializing in Iraqi law are essential.
  • Cultural Sensitivity: Building strong relationships in Iraq requires cultural sensitivity and an understanding of local customs and business etiquette.
